The One-Handed Backhand Is Back In The Top 10

The One-Handed Backhand Is Back In The Top 10

[ad_1] Last month, there was fear within the tennis fraternity that the one-handed backhand was becoming an extinct shot. On February 19th, 2024, the ATP rankings did not have a single player with a one-handed backhand.
